2018年9月12日 星期三

打開HBA硬碟卡上面的指示燈LED

若硬碟裝在HBA卡上(參閱《硬碟用HBA(Host bus adapter)卡》),那故障的時候就無法用一般磁碟陣列卡的控制程式來顯示故障的硬碟。取而代之的方法是用第三方軟體來控制故障硬碟的指示燈。下面的指令教學使用:
  1. dmesg -T
  2. smartctl -a /dev/sdk
  3. wget http://www.supermicro.com/support/faqs/data_lib/FAQ_9633_SAS2IRCU_Phase_5.0-5.00.00.00.zip && unzip FAQ_9633_SAS2IRCU_Phase_5.0-5.00.00.00.zip  && cd sas2ircu_linux_x86_rel/
  4. ./sas2ircu --help
  5. ./sas2ircu 0 DISPLAY
  6. ./sas2ircu 0 locate 1:9 on
  7. ./sas2ircu 0 locate 1:9 off
上述指令的意思是:
  1. 用read error為關鍵字搜尋故障的硬碟編號,例如說sdk
  2. 看故障硬碟的型號與序號
  3. 下載第三方軟體SAS2IRCU
  4. 顯示sas2ircu的使用方式
  5. 顯示第一張卡(標示為0,若有第二張卡就是1)上面所有的硬碟,根據步驟2看到的型號確認enclosure與slot,這邊的sdk在第一張卡的第1個enclosure的第9個slot
  6. 打開故障硬碟的指示燈
  7. 關閉故障硬碟的指示燈

參考資料

_EOF_

沒有留言:

張貼留言